Island View Campground is perfectly situated at 19357 Islandview Pl, Mystic, IA 52574, USA. Mystic is a small town located in Appanoose County, in the southern part of Iowa. This location places the campground directly on the beautiful shores of Lake Rathbun, one of Iowa's largest and most popular recreational lakes, often referred to as "Iowa's Ocean" due to its vast expanse. Spacious Campsites: The campground is noted for its "HUGE sites," with "most were double-wide so you could fit boat or extra vehicle easily," providing ample space and privacy for campers.
Electric-Only Hookups: Sites offer "Electric only" hookups. Campers will need to "stop at dump station to fill with water" upon arrival, or utilize "a few spigots located throughout park too" for water access.
Dump Station: A dedicated dump station is available for campers to fill their fresh water tanks and dispose of wastewater.
Well-Maintained Facilities: The campground is consistently described as "Clean, well maintained sites," indicating a high standard of upkeep across the park.
Friendly and Helpful Staff: Visitors have noted the presence of "Friendly helpful staff," contributing to a positive and welcoming camping experience.
Open Space: The campground boasts "Acres of open space throughout," offering expansive areas for recreation, walking, and enjoying the natural surroundings.
Exceptional Lake Rathbun Views: A major highlight is that "Many of the sites had EXCEPTIONAL views of the Lake Rathbun," providing stunning vistas right from your campsite. This makes it a prime location for enjoying sunrises, sunsets, and the general beauty of the lake.

We camped in mid-September when park was less than 25% full. HUGE sites, most were double-wide so you could fit boat or extra vehicle easily. Electric only at site, so you need to stop at dump station to fill with water. (A few spigots located throughout park too.) Campground is a couple of miles from highway entrance but such a beautiful drive. Acres of open space throughout.
Clean, well maintained sites. Many of the sites had EXCEPTIONAL views of the Lake Rathbun. Friendly helpful staff. There are so many Wonderful Army Corp of Engineers campgrounds in this state.
